Trade Liberalization and Unemployment: Theory and Evidence from India

Using state and industry-level unemployment and trade protection data from India, we find no evidence of any unemployment increasing effect of trade reforms. In fact, our state-level analysis reveals that urban unemployment declines with liberalization in states with flexible labor markets and larger employment shares in net exporter industries.
